As a sample of the number of functions of strapping tools in daily life, they can be utilized for reinforcement. Reinforcement would be expanding the structural strength and even intensity of a container. When choosing strapping, they need to ask themselves, “precisely how far would the product be mailed?”, to determine the level of reinforcement required. Black steel metal is regarded as the most cost-effective possibility as well as more secure to use for strapping, resulting from its own rounded off borders. The three main forms of strapping are black steel metal strapping, apex steel metal strapping, and even zinc coated steel metal strapping.

Management of Storage as applications of strapping tools in everyday life: Where the load is going to be collected, and even the length of time it will be stored for, both effect strapping alternatives. Weight of a load for strapping: Excess weight, in addition impacts the strapping style and also the dimensions the strapping that may be appropriate to use. Travelling and even Buyer Management Concerns: they need to contemplate with regards to the shipment of what they produce and ask themselves, “precisely what is the means of shipping they will utilise?”

Tiedowns and even Bracing as applications of strapping tools in everyday life: Tie down for lading on an open-top automobile is an additional technique wherein strapping puts a stop to damages. In addition, there is a routine strapping pattern that will incorporate the sideways and even upright straps for reinforcement.

Usually, bundling as applications of strapping tools in everyday life is used as a tool to contain very long, skinny forms, including tubing as well as smaller dimension pipe. Baling, on the other hand, reduces down cube sizing and even creates the load with a uniform weight, making it much easier to collect, control and even retail. Unitizing: Unitizing a lot typically comprises of unpackaged things, including corrugated cartons, timbers, concrete blocks, and even bricks.

Pilferage Protection: Strapping can be utilised to hinder pilferage. Loads unitised with strapping helps make pilferage an awful liability for thieves. When deciding on strapping, they need to ask themselves, “exactly how dependable is the uniform weight of a load?” Crates as well as wood packing containers beefed up with steel metal strapping, greatly reduce the range of nails called for and also the volume and even the width of timbers.
